Write a story about elevation that this expression could represent: 56 + (-56)
Ostrovityanka [42]

The correct statement that represents the expression is:

  • An object moves towards the east (positive direction )at a distance of 56m and west (negative direction) at the same distance, the total displacement of the object is 0m

Given the expression 56 + (-56).

  • We can see that this is an inverse rule where a value and its negative are added together.

Let us assume the values are distance covered by an object.

The correct statement that represents the expression is:

  • An object moves towards the east (positive direction )at a distance of 56m and west (negative direction) at the same distance, the total displacement of the object is 0m

This show that  56 + (-56) = 56 - 56 = 0

Find the value of x, giving reasons for your answer:
Dmitry [639]

Answer:

145 degrees.

Step-by-step explanation:

Because the lines are the same length on each half we know that the corner opposite to the right angle is also a rangle. In a quadrilateral (4 sided shape) the angles should add up to 360 degrees. We now have the total as x + 35 + 90 + 90 = 360 which when rearranged gives x = 145 degrees.
